Popular singer and Grammy-winning songwriter Brett James has died in a plane crash in Franklin, North Carolina, United States.

Authorities revealed that the small aircraft crashed in a field near a local school. The 57-year-old singer-songwriter was on board with two other passengers; all three were killed. Police confirmed that no students or staff at the nearby school were injured. The plane had departed from John C. Tune Airport in Nashville, Tennessee.

Born in Oklahoma, James was one of Nashville’s most accomplished songwriters, with a career spanning more than two decades. He gained fame as a co-writer of Carrie Underwood’s breakout hit Jesus, Take the Wheel, which won the 2006 Grammy Award for Best Country Song. The track not only propelled Underwood to stardom but also established James as a masterful songwriter capable of blending heartfelt storytelling with mainstream appeal.

Over his career, James penned chart-topping hits for country and pop artists alike. His credits include Kenny Chesney’s Out Last Night, Bon Jovi’s Who Says You Can’t Go Home, and collaborations with Taylor Swift and Keith Urban. His songs appeared on albums that collectively sold more than 110 million copies, earning him recognition as one of Nashville’s most versatile and dependable collaborators.

Beyond commercial success, James earned the respect of peers for his creativity, dedication, and mentorship. He wrote or co-wrote more than 500 songs recorded by some of the biggest names in music. Fellow musicians often described him as a cornerstone of the Nashville songwriting community, equally skilled at crafting moving ballads, energetic anthems, or crossover hits.

James also dedicated time to mentoring young songwriters, helping shape the next generation of country music talent. His ability to balance traditional storytelling with modern sounds left a lasting mark on the genre.

The crash is under investigation, with the National Transportation Safety Board expected to conduct a full inquiry into the cause.

James is survived by his family, friends, and countless collaborators who remember him as a devoted father, colleague, and friend. His passing is a significant loss for the music industry, leaving behind a legacy of songs that will continue to resonate with audiences around the world.
